Racial Distribution

The racial distribution of information science majors in Alaska is as follows:

  • Asian: 8.3%
  • Black or African American: 0.0%
  • Hispanic or Latino: 8.3%
  • White: 50.0%
  • Non-Resident Alien: 0.0%
  • Other Races: 33.3%

Jobs for Information Science Grads in Alaska

1,240 people in the state and 1,240,640 in the nation are employed in jobs related to information science.

Wages for Information Science Jobs in Alaska

In this state, information science grads earn an average of $107,610. Nationwide, they make an average of $114,000.
